Right here are some questions you may desire to ask when choosing a MIC that's right for you: What is the optimum Financing to Value of a home mortgage? I would take into consideration anything over 75% to be also risky.


What is the mix between 1st and 2nd home loans? What is the dimension of the MIC fund? This information can be discovered in the offering memorandum which is the MIC matching of a shared fund syllabus.


Some MICs have limitations on the withdrawal procedure. The MIC I have actually chosen is Antrim Investments.


I feel like the asset allotment, anticipated returns, and diversity of actual estate for this MIC match my danger resistance and financial investment needs so that's why I picked this one. Over the last 3 years the yearly return has actually been 7.17% to investors, so I will think as the anticipated return on my new $10,000 MIC investment for the time being.

A preferred trustee in B.C. and Alberta is Canadian Western Depend On. To open an account with Canadian Western we merely submit an application type which can be found on its internet site. Next we give directions to our trustee to buy shares of the MIC we desire. Here's my example.


We'll also need to mail a cheque to the trustee which will represent our initial deposit. Regarding 2 weeks later we should see cash in our new trust account There is an annual cost to hold a TFSA account with Canadian Western, and a $100 purchase cost to make any type of buy or market orders.


I expect to obtain quarterly rate of interest settlements on my new financial investment starting following month - Mortgage Investment Corporation. But MICs aren't all that and a bag of potato chips There are genuine threats too. Like any loan contract there's constantly the chance for the customer to back-pedal the financial debt. Nonetheless many MICs preserve a margin of safety and security by keeping a practical funding to worth proportion.
